Job Responsibilities:
  • Coordinates, schedules and conducts hands-on, one-on-one, classroom, or group skills training on a variety of topics, including new hire job orientation, safety and environmental health, certification and/or recertification, retraining, new equipment introduction, equipment operation, operational processes and procedures, “right to know”, etc. Identifies and implements opportunities for process improvements (e.g. documentation, reporting, communication, training specifics, system processes, procedures, etc.).
  • Evaluates, tracks and maintains an accurate database/files of associates’ progress through observation, demonstrated learning, testing, documented certification processes, etc, and determines appropriate training solutions. Provides updates to, interacts with and solicits feedback from management, department and/or temporary employment agencies regarding training activities (e.g. weekly or monthly training progress reports, statistical reporting, procedure task failures and viable solutions).
  • Researches operational and equipment processes by performing online searches, contacting vendors, observing processes in action, asking clarifying questions, and taking notes to accurately develop and maintain documentation. Collaborates with Engineering and Production to develop and test new operational processes and procedures. Communicates procedural changes appropriately and timely.
  • Plans, organizes, creates and maintains/updates documentation, such as training manuals, operational and equipment procedures and processes, forms, certification materials, skill assessments, training calendars, illustrations, training aids, train-the-trainer materials, task lists, technical documentation and unique procedure tasks that would result in failure if the normal procedure was followed. Coordinates the annual revisions of documentation, including establishing and managing deadlines. Reviews and edits documentation from vendors and/or other departments. Researches, gathers and organizes documentation requested for various audits (e.g. quality, SAS70, OSHA, and MPTQM). May administer the Production Learning Center (training records and procedures database).
  • Analyzes and forecasts departmental training needs. Identifies and ensures achievement of short and long term training goals/objectives. Identifies and administers training requirements. May participate in the coordination of departmental business continuity planning (BCP) activities by preparing and scheduling testing exercises.
  • Functions as a post-training mentor. Helps foster a continuous learning environment. Provides guidance and counsel on employee training issues, including the recommendation for soft-skills training classes. May mentor and provide guidance to other trainers. Attends internal and/or external training to improve training skills and subject matter knowledge (e.g., facilitation skills, adult learning knowledge, evaluation skills). May lead shift trainer meetings and classes to ensure trainers conduct consistent, up-to-date training.
  • Follows all departmental and safety procedures. May perform other duties/responsibilities as needed or as assigned.
